About Lori Sue Rubenstein at a glance
Lori Sue Rubenstein is a Principal based in Cottonwood, Arizona, practicing at Lori S. Rubenstein, L.L.C.. They have 39+ years of legal experience, licensed to practice since 1987. Their practice focuses on family law and civil rights. Admitted to practice in Pennsylvania (1987), U.S. District Court, Middle District of Pennsylvania (1988), Oregon (1991), and U.S. District, District of Oregon (1991). Educated at Antioch School of Law (J.D., 1985) and University of Nevada (B.A., 1982). Recognitions include CV Notable. Active member of Dauphin and Douglas County, Pennsylvania and American Bar Associations Oregon State Bar. Serands clients in Cottonwood, AZ and the surrounding metropolitan area.
